Memo — Loyalty Programme Overhaul

Finance team: the Brightmark Rewards scheme will be restructured next quarter. Points accrual drops from 2% to 1.5%, and the Silver tier merges into Standard. Estimated annual savings: 340K, partly reinvested in the new Corvale partner network. Accrual liability must be restated before quarter-end. The confidential rollout plan appears below.

board note of tafog-fawep: Gorwynix Holdings is in early talks to buy Pramirax Holdings for about $358.6 million. The Lamix launch date is April 27, and nothing goes to the press before then. Legal wants the Normirek Holdings term sheet countersigned before August 7.

HANDOVER NOTE — Director transition, Merrow & Stave Ltd.
From: A. Kessling (outgoing) To: P. Durnow (incoming)

Key item: hiring freeze in the Fieldworks Division remains in force. No exceptions approved since March. Two backfills pending — hold until Q3 review. Branch managers have been told to manage with temp cover only; expect pushback from Northgate and Ellsmere branches. Budget line for contractors is capped. Do not signal any thaw in communications. The rationale and forward intent are captured in the confidential note below.

board note of tadup-tajog: Headcount on the Oliiel team goes from 31 to 88 by the end of February. Gross margin on Oliiel came in at 62 percent against a plan of 29 percent.

## Limits & quotas: websocket reconnects

Heads up, new folks — the infamous Bridgelow reconnect bug happened because clients hammered the gateway with zero backoff after a deploy, tripping the per-node connection quota and cascading. We've since enforced jittered backoff server-side and capped reconnect attempts per window. If you're writing a client, respect these limits or the gateway will shed you anyway. The quotas currently enforced are listed here.

limits module of fajog-tawig:
RATE_LIMITS = {
    "druwyn": 2,
    "quenael": 10,
    "wenix": 2,
    "druael": 2,
}

Subject: Incoming reservoir samples — Thornvale run

To the warehouse shift lead: the courier from Aldgate Hydrology will deliver twelve sealed water samples drawn from Thornvale Reservoir this afternoon. Please verify each seal against the manifest, record temperatures on arrival, and move the cooler directly to cold storage. The confidential hand-over instruction appears directly below.

handover note for yagef-bagep: the drudor pelius courier leaves the kasdor zorvan norir ledger at gate 8016 under passcode 755406